THE MISSION OF THE FOOD BANK OF GREENWOOD COUNTY IS TO REDUCE HUNGER THROUGH COMMUNITY COOPERATION, EFFECTIVELY DISTRIBUTING DONATED GROCERY PRODUCTS AND PERISHABLE FOODS, AND MAKING THE BEST POSSIBLE USE OF ALL AVAILABLE RESOURCES.
FOOD BANK OF GREENWOOD COUNTY is a Public Charity headquartered in GREENWOOD, SC. Financial data from the 2024 filing: $1.1M revenue, $1.3M expenses, $264K total assets. 11 publicly reported grants to this organization, totaling roughly $66K, appear in IRS filings.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$1.1M | $1.3M | $264K |
| 2023 | $864K | $851K | $239K |
| 2022 | $529K | $486K | $226K |
| 2021 | $217K | $125K | $183K |
| 2020 | $471K | $641K | $139K |
Between 2020 and 2024, reported annual revenue grew from $471K to $1.1M (+143%), with total assets most recently reported at $264K.
